TRGP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review

243 of the 3,479 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Targa Resources (TRGP)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$4.8B — up 41% from $3.41B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 52 funds opened new TRGP positions and 24 closed out — a net gain of 28 holders — while 80 added to existing stakes and 91 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$78.5M. The largest seller was BlackRock Fund Advisors, cutting an estimated $67.6M.
